Jarszewko () is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Stepnica, within Goleniów County, West Pomeranian Voivodeship, in north-western Poland. It lies approximately from Szczecin and from Świnoujście. The village lies on the coast of the Szczecin Lagoon.

It was first mentioned in 1590, and belonged to the family of von Flemming.
